Additional charges for waiting time or delays

Here’s the good news: our airport transfer service from London to Heathrow Airport won’t charge extra fees if your flight runs late. We monitor your flight status continuously, so delays don’t trigger surprise costs on your bill.

You can relax during your journey without watching the clock.

It’s worth knowing what self-drivers and friends picking you up are dealing with at the airport. According to the 2026 Heathrow Airport drop-off regulations, the terminal drop-off charge increased to £7 in January 2026, with a strict 10-minute maximum stay limit at the forecourts. Any vehicle that overstays faces an £80 Parking Charge Notice. That kind of pressure turns a simple pick-up into a stressful race against the clock. With a professional transfer, none of that falls on your shoulders.

For context on how private transfers compare to public transport, the 2026 Elizabeth Line rail fare from Zone 1 to Heathrow is £15.50 per person via contactless payment, according to 2026 Transport for London fare data. For a solo traveller, that’s a useful benchmark. For a family of four, a shared private vehicle often works out cheaper once you add up the individual fares, and it takes you directly to your destination without luggage on escalators or tube connections.
